Sistema: Gerenciador de Aplicativos Prosoft (GAP)

Contexto: Este artigo tem como objetivo orientar o usuário em como proceder quando ao anexar a base no SQL, retorna erro 5 (Acesso negado)

Informações Adicionais:  Não se aplica



1 - Ao tentar anexar a base de dados no SQL, retorna:

Mensagem 5133, Nível 16, Estado 1, Linha 3 Directory lookup for the file "C:\Pasta\PROEMPXX\ANF\ProANF_XPROEMPXX.mdf" failed with the operating system error 5(Acesso negado.).


Script para Anexar base no SQL:


USE [master]

GO

CREATE DATABASE [ProANF_XPROEMPXX] ON

( FILENAME = N'C:\Pasta\PROEMPXX\ANF\ProANF_XPROEMPXX.mdf' ),

( FILENAME = N'C:\Pasta\PROEMPXX\ANF\ProANF_XPROEMPXX_log.ldf' )

FOR ATTACH


2 - A falha ocorre por falta a permissão para o usuário Todos (Everyone) na pasta.



3 - Clique em Adicionar, inclua o usuário TODOS (everyone) e aplique a permissão de Controle Total e aplique a permissão.



4 - Feito o procedimento, a base será anexada com sucesso no banco.






  • Sem rótulos